Skip to main content

IZ56227: READ TO A SOCKET BLOCKS CONCURRENT WRITES


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Error Message:
    
    
    .
    Stack Trace:
    
    3XMTHREADINFO      "IM_POOL_THREAD_0" (TID:0x094F9B00,
    sys_thread_t:0x09308D18, state:B, native ID:0x0000164E) prio=5
    4XESTACKTRACE          at
    java/nio/channels/spi/AbstractSelectableChannel.isBlocking(Abstr
    actSelectableChannel.java:257)
    4XESTACKTRACE          at
    java/nio/channels/spi/AbstractInterruptibleChannel.begin(Abstrac
    tInterruptibleChannel.java:180)
    4XESTACKTRACE          at
    sun/nio/ch/SocketChannelImpl.write(SocketChannelImpl.java:326(Co
    mpiled Code))
    4XESTACKTRACE          at
    com/xxxxxx/ca/xmpp/smack/XMPPAsyncConnection$MyWriter.flush(XMPP
    AsyncConnection.java:187(Compiled Code))
    4XESTACKTRACE          at
    java/io/BufferedWriter.flush(BufferedWriter.java:257)
    .
    .
    A blocking read on a socket blocks concurrent writes.
    The writer can be seen waiting in
    AbstractSelectableChannel.isBlocking( ).
    

Local fix

Problem summary

  • Hang scenario is observed due to a feature introduced for better
    performance.
    

Problem conclusion

  • This defect will be fixed in:
    5.0.0 SR?
    .
    JDK codebase is update to avoid the hang scenario caused due a
    feature.
    .
    To obtain the fix:
    Install build 20090916 or later
    

Temporary fix

Comments

APAR Information

  • APAR number

    IZ56227

  • Reported component name

    JAVA 5 CLASS LI

  • Reported component ID

    620500130

  • Reported release

    500

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2009-08-03

  • Closed date

    2009-09-17

  • Last modified date

    2009-09-17

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    JAVA 5 CLASS LI

  • Fixed component ID

    620500130

Applicable component levels

  • R500 PSN

       UP

Rate this page:

(0 users)Average rating

Copyright and trademark information

IBM, the IBM logo and ibm.com are trademarks of International Business Machines Corp., registered in many jurisdictions worldwide. Other product and service names might be trademarks of IBM or other companies. A current list of IBM trademarks is available on the Web at "Copyright and trademark information" at www.ibm.com/legal/copytrade.shtml.

Rate this page:


(0 users)Average rating

Add comments

Document information

Runtimes for Java Technology

Java Class Libraries


Software version:
5.0


Reference #:
IZ56227


Modified date:
2009-09-17

Translate my page

Content navigation